In this instance ... WebUtilitarianism. Utilitarianism is an ethical theory that determines right from wrong by focusing on outcomes. It is a form of consequentialism. Utilitarianism holds that the most ethical choice is the one that will produce the greatest good for the greatest number. Business ethics is relevant both to the conduct of individuals and to the conduct of the … WebSep 21, 2024 · What is a code of ethics, can be described as a set of values that guides the behaviour and decision-making process of an organisation and its people. Companies may create a code of ethics in the form of a document that outlines their core values. The ethical code document usually sets out the broad standards to follow while conducting business ...

WebMar 10, 2024 · There are many examples of ways you can have an ethical work environment, including: 1. Report conflicts of interest. Many organizations have a policy regarding receiving gifts from clients or other external parties. Some may even have rules about part-time work, freelance opportunities and other side jobs.
